XML 56 R42.htm IDEA: XBRL DOCUMENT v3.20.4
Acquisitions, Goodwill And Other Intangible Assets (Summary of Estimated Amortization Expense) (Details)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2020
Dec. 31, 2019
Dec. 31, 2018
Finite-Lived Intangible Assets      
Amortization expense $ 37,873 $ 23,758 $ 21,262
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ity      
2019 41,499    
2020 40,661    
2021 39,583    
2022 38,110    
2023 34,909    
Cost of Sales      
Finite-Lived Intangible Assets      
Amortization expense 5,101 5,200 5,350
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ity      
2019 5,554    
2020 5,208    
2021 4,782    
2022 4,329    
2023 3,465    
Selling, General and Administrative Expenses      
Finite-Lived Intangible Assets      
Amortization expense 32,772 $ 18,558 $ 15,912
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ity      
2019 35,945    
2020 35,453    
2021 34,801    
2022 33,781    
2023 $ 31,444